Solution structure of Psb27 from cyanobacterial photosystem II Biochemistry, 48:8771-8773, 2009 Cited by PubMed Abstract: Psb27 is a highly conserved component of photosystem II. The three-dimensional structure has a well-defined helical core, composed of four helices arranged in a right-handed up-down-up-down fold, with a less ordered region of the structure located at the N-terminus. The position of conserved residues on the surface suggests conserved functional roles for distinct interconnected features encompassing a P-phi-P loop, a polar patch spanning helices alpha3 and alpha4, and the N-terminal sequence.
